在金融市场的浩瀚宇宙中,期货市场以其独特的杠杆效应、高风险高收益特性吸引着无数投资者的目光,随着科技的飞速发展,特别是计算机技术和算法的日新月异,期货交易方式也经历了深刻的变革,期货程序化交易作为现代金融科技的产物,正逐渐成为市场的主流交易方式之一,本文将深入探讨期货程序化交易的核心概念、运作机制、优势、挑战以及未来的发展趋势,旨在为投资者提供全面而深入的理解。
期货程序化交易的定义与原理
期货程序化交易,顾名思义,是指利用预先设定好的计算机程序,根据特定的交易策略和市场数据,自动执行买卖决策的一种交易方式,它基于量化分析,通过数学模型和算法对市场走势进行预测,并据此快速做出交易反应,这一过程几乎完全排除了人为情绪干扰,实现了交易的客观性和一致性。
程序化交易的核心在于交易策略的制定与实现,这些策略可以基于技术指标(如移动平均线、相对强弱指数RSI等)、基本面分析(如供需关系、宏观经济指标等)、统计套利(如配对交易、均值回归等)或是机器学习算法等多种方法构建,一旦策略确定,开发者会将其编写为计算机代码,部署在交易平台上,由系统自动监控市场变化,并在满足特定条件时自动执行交易指令。
期货程序化交易的优势
-
高效执行:程序化交易能够在毫秒级甚至更短的时间内对市场变化做出反应,远快于人工操作,从而捕捉到更多的交易机会。
-
客观决策:排除了人为情绪的影响,交易决策完全基于预设的策略和算法,提高了交易的纪律性和一致性,避免了因情绪波动导致的非理性交易。
-
风险管理:程序化交易通常内置严格的风险管理模块,如止损、止盈、仓位控制等,能够有效控制交易风险,避免重大损失。
-
策略多样化:借助计算机强大的计算能力,投资者可以设计和测试多种复杂的交易策略,不断优化投资组合,提高收益潜力。
-
持续学习与适应:部分高级程序化交易系统还能利用机器学习技术,从历史数据中学习并自我优化,逐步适应市场变化,提高交易效率。
期货程序化交易面临的挑战
尽管程序化交易具有诸多优势,但其也面临着不容忽视的挑战:
-
技术与资源门槛:开发和维护一个高效的程序化交易系统需要专业的编程知识、深厚的金融理论基础以及强大的计算资源,这对于个人投资者而言可能是一个不小的障碍。
-
过度拟合与策略失效:在策略开发过程中,如果过度追求历史数据的拟合度,可能会导致策略在未来市场中的表现不佳,即所谓的“过度拟合”,市场结构和行为的变化也可能导致原本有效的策略失效。
-
监管风险:随着程序化交易的普及,监管机构对其的监管也在不断加强,以防范市场操纵、不公平交易等行为,政策调整可能给程序化交易带来不确定性。
-
技术故障与网络安全:高度依赖技术的交易系统容易遭受技术故障、黑客攻击等风险,一旦系统出现问题,可能导致交易中断或资金损失。
期货程序化交易的发展趋势
-
智能化升级:随着人工智能、大数据、云计算等技术的不断进步,期货程序化交易将向更高层次的智能化发展,如通过深度学习预测市场趋势,实现更精准的交易决策。
-
跨市场融合:程序化交易系统将不仅仅局限于单一市场,而是能够实现跨市场、跨品种的交易策略,进一步提高资金配置效率和风险管理能力。
-
定制化服务:为了满足不同投资者的个性化需求,程序化交易平台将提供更加灵活的策略定制服务,用户可以根据自己的风险偏好和投资目标,选择或定制适合自己的交易策略。
-
监管科技(RegTech)的应用:为了应对监管挑战,程序化交易领域将更多地融入监管科技,通过技术手段提高合规性,确保交易的公平、透明和安全。
-
教育与普及:随着技术的成熟和市场的认可,程序化交易的教育和培训将更加普及,降低技术门槛,使更多投资者能够参与到这一高效、科学的交易方式中来。
期货程序化交易作为金融科技的前沿阵地,正以其独特的魅力改变着期货市场的生态格局,它不仅提高了交易效率,降低了人为错误,还为投资者提供了前所未有的策略多样性和风险管理工具,面对技术、监管、市场等多方面的挑战,程序化交易的发展之路并非坦途,随着技术的不断进步和市场的日益成熟,我们有理由相信,期货程序化交易将在更加规范、智能、高效的轨道上继续前行,为金融市场带来更多的创新与活力,对于投资者而言,把握这一趋势,不断学习和探索,将是通往成功的重要路径。